Provision Would Shift Terror Cases to Military

A provision in the Senate’s version of the omnibus Pentagon spending measure shortly before Congress adjourned for its summer recess would shift all terror suspects into immediate military custody, dodging the civilian authorities traditionally tasked with such cases....

Most of 9/11 Commission Report Still Classified

Ten years after the al Qaeda attacks on New York and Washington, most of the 9/11 Commission's findings have not been released to the public, despite the fact that the National Archives were scheduled to release the full material in 2009. Only a third of the...
